比特币钱包多重签名失效原因及解决方法
什么是比特币钱包多重签名?
比特币钱包多重签名是一种安全机制,需要多个私钥的授权才能完成交易。这个安全特性使得比特币交易更加可靠和具有防护性。但有时,多重签名可能会失效。下面我们将逐个问题详细介绍比特币钱包多重签名失效的原因和解决方法。
比特币钱包多重签名失效的可能原因有哪些?
1. 私钥丢失或泄露:如果多重签名需要使用的某个私钥丢失或被泄露,将导致无法进行多重签名。
2. 节点离线或网络故障:多重签名需要经过比特币网络上的节点进行确认,如果节点离线或网络出现故障,将导致无法进行多重签名。
3. 不正确的多重签名设置:如果比特币钱包的多重签名设置有误,比如设置的签名数量不正确或设置的公钥无效,将导致多重签名失效。
4. 比特币网络分叉:如果比特币网络出现分叉,即存在不同版本的区块链,多重签名的有效性可能会受到影响。
5. 第三方服务故障:如果使用了第三方的多重签名服务,当该服务出现故障或关闭时,多重签名也会失效。
6. 比特币协议更新:如果比特币协议发生更新,可能会导致钱包的多重签名部分失效。
私钥丢失或泄露导致的多重签名失效如何解决?
如果私钥丢失或泄露,可以尝试以下解决方案:
1. 恢复备份:如果有备份的私钥,可以使用备份来恢复多重签名的功能。
2. 重新生成私钥:如果无法找回原有私钥,可以重新生成新的私钥,并更新多重签名设置。
3. 增加额外的签名者:如果使用了多个签名者的多重签名方案,可以增加新的签名者,替换已泄露或丢失的私钥。
节点离线或网络故障导致的多重签名失效如何解决?
如果遇到节点离线或网络故障导致的多重签名失效,可以尝试以下解决方案:
1. 检查网络连接:确保网络连接正常,尝试重新连接节点。
2. 更换节点:如果当前节点不可用,可以尝试更换其他可靠的节点。
3. 等待网络恢复:如果是网络故障引起的问题,可以等待网络恢复正常后再进行多重签名。
不正确的多重签名设置导致的失效如何解决?
如果多重签名设置有误导致失效,可以按照以下步骤解决:
1. 仔细检查设置:确认多重签名的设置是否符合要求,包括签名数量、公钥正确性等。
2. 重新设置:如果发现设置有误,可以尝试重新设置多重签名,确保设置正确。
比特币网络分叉导致的多重签名失效如何解决?
如果比特币网络出现分叉导致多重签名失效,可以尝试以下解决方案:
1. 确认网络状态:查看比特币网络是否出现分叉,可以通过查看区块链浏览器或咨询相关社区获取信息。
2. 等待分叉解决:如果是暂时的分叉,可以等待分叉问题解决后再进行多重签名。
3. 更新钱包软件:有时,钱包软件的更新可能会修复因分叉引起多重签名失效的问题。
问题7:第三方服务故障导致的多重签名失效如何解决?
如果使用的第三方多重签名服务出现故障,可以考虑以下解决方案:
1. 寻找替代方案:寻找其他可靠的第三方多重签名服务,将多重签名迁移到可用的服务上。
2. 自行管理私钥:如果不想依赖第三方服务,可以自行管理私钥并使用比特币钱包软件进行多重签名。
问题8:比特币协议更新导致的多重签名失效如何解决?
如果比特币协议更新导致多重签名失效,可以尝试以下解决方案:
1. 更新钱包软件:确保使用的比特币钱包软件是最新版本,以适应协议的更新。
2. 寻找兼容性解决方案:如果钱包软件不支持最新协议,可以尝试寻找适用于最新协议的兼容性解决方案。
希望以上内容能够帮助您理解比特币钱包多重签名失效的原因和解决方法。